Getting There

  • Walking

    From the Royal Palace, head south along Samdach Sothearos Boulevard for about 1 kilometer. You will pass several local cafes and shops on your way. Continue straight until you reach Wat Botum Park, which will be on your right side, just before you reach the intersection with Street 184.

  • Tuk-tuk

    Hail a tuk-tuk from anywhere in central Phnom Penh. Tell the driver 'Wat Botum Park' or show them the address: HW6J+FX4, Samdach Sothearos Blvd (3). The ride should take about 5-10 minutes, depending on traffic. Ask the driver to drop you off at the entrance of the park, which is easily recognizable.

  • Bicycle

    If you have rented a bicycle, start from the Riverside area. Head east on Sisowath Quay, then turn left onto Street 154. Continue until you reach Samdach Sothearos Boulevard, then turn right. Pedal south for approximately 500 meters, and you will find Wat Botum Park on your right.

  • Motorbike taxi

    To get to Wat Botum Park via a motorbike taxi, find a nearby motorbike taxi stand or use a ride-hailing app. Provide the driver with the address: HW6J+FX4, Samdach Sothearos Blvd (3). The journey should take around 10 minutes and cost a small fee, typically around $1 to $2.

Discover more about Wat Botum Park

Wat Botum Park is one of Phnom Penh's most cherished green spaces, offering a refreshing escape from the city's bustling streets. Located near the Royal Palace and the riverfront, the park is an ideal spot for both locals and tourists looking to unwind amidst nature. Spanning several hectares, the park is adorned with vibrant flora and tranquil pathways, perfect for a leisurely stroll or a peaceful picnic. Visitors will be captivated by the serene ambiance, making it a perfect location to relax, read a book, or simply enjoy people-watching. The park features a variety of trees, flowers, and manicured lawns, providing a picturesque setting for photographs and leisurely explorations. In addition to its natural beauty, Wat Botum Park holds cultural significance. The park is home to the Wat Botum Vatey pagoda, one of the oldest and most revered temples in Phnom Penh. This spiritual site attracts both worshippers and curious visitors, offering a glimpse into the rich Buddhist tradition of Cambodia. Tourists can enjoy the intricate architecture of the pagoda, which features stunning decorative elements and serene statues that evoke a sense of peace and contemplation. Families will find plenty of space for children to play, with a designated playground area that features swings, slides, and climbing structures. The park is also a popular venue for community events, cultural festivals, and art exhibitions, making it a vibrant hub of local life.
